S_ACT (Secondary Active Contact Output) / P_ACT (Primary Active Contact Output):
The S_ACT and P_ACT contact outputs will inform the external device whether the primary or
secondary is active.
For example, when the RU status switches to the primary, the P_ACT is close contact,
and S_ACT is open contact.
S_WD (Secondary Watching Dog Contact Inputs) / P_WD (Primary Watching Dog Contact
Inputs):
Connect the P_WD and S_WD inputs to the the Bypass Mode output on IDA8 processor. When
IDA8 enters the bypass mode, the Bypass Mode output will inform the RU units, and the RU unit
will determine whether to activate the primary IDA8 or the secondary IDA8 processor by the
monitored P_WD and S_WD contact inputs.
The basic philosophy is that the master RU unit monitors the P_WD and S_WD inputs coming
from the primary and secondary IDA8 processors and decide which one can be active, and also
passes the decision to next RU units through EXP_OUT terminal. See the table as below.
For example, when RU detects P_WD and S_WD contact are closed, it switches to the
primary.
If the RU unit is set as the slave RU unit, it monitors the S_WD which connects to the
master RU unit, resulting in setting the primary or secondary IDA8 processors to be active.
Master/Slave Switch:
A DIP switch to set RU-PDC be master or slave. The difference between master and slave
please refer to item "(S_WD)Secondary Watching Dog".
3.3.3 RU-PDC
RU-PDC device is a device supplied with full-redundancy for audio processor. It is in charge of
switching primary and secondary audio processor to active one of them. If primary audio processor is
active, all signal of peripherals shall be directed to the primary audio processor. RU-PDC device is
also capable to monitor the status of audio processor. If primary audio processor breaks down, RU-
PDC device will detect automatically and switch to secondary audio processor.
